12C+12C fusion is important for understanding the late phases of stellar evolution as well as the ignition and nucleosynthesis in cataclysmic binary systems such as type Ia supernovae and x-ray superbursts. A new measurement of this reaction has been performed at the University of Notre Dame using particle-γ coincidence techquies with SAND (a silicon detector array) at the high-intensity 5U Pelletron accelerator.
